Biblical Strategies for Overcoming Lust
The Bible offers several strategies for overcoming lust, grounded in the understanding that true victory comes from a deep, abiding relationship with God.
Renewal of the Mind: The apostle Paul encourages believers to be transformed by the renewing of their minds (Romans 12:2), suggesting that overcoming lust begins with a mental and spiritual transformation. This involves filling one’s mind with pure thoughts, meditating on scripture, and cultivating a mindset that reflects God’s design for sexuality and relationships.
Accountability and Community: The importance of community and accountability is highlighted throughout the Bible. Surrounding oneself with people who share the goal of living a pure life and who can offer support and encouragement is crucial. The Bible teaches that as iron sharpens iron, so one person sharpens another (Proverbs 27:17), indicating the value of mutual support in spiritual growth.
Prayer and Fasting: Prayer and fasting are presented as powerful tools for spiritual growth and self-control. Through these practices, individuals can seek God’s strength in their struggle against lust, asking for the grace to overcome and the wisdom to live according to God’s will.
Self-Control as a Fruit of the Spirit: The Bible teaches that self-control is a fruit of the Spirit (Galatians 5:23), indicating that the ability to control one’s desires and actions is a result of the Holy Spirit’s work in a believer’s life. Cultivating a relationship with God through the Holy Spirit is essential for developing the self-control needed to overcome lust.
Purity of Heart: Jesus taught that blessed are the pure in heart, for they shall see God (Matthew 5:8). The pursuit of a pure heart is fundamental to overcoming lust. This involves seeking forgiveness for past sins, committing to a life of purity, and trusting in God’s power to transform one’s heart.
The Role of Forgiveness and Redemption
Central to the biblical message is the concept of forgiveness and redemption. For those who have struggled with lust, the knowledge that they can be forgiven and redeemed is a powerful motivator for change. The Bible promises that if we confess our sins, God is faithful and just to forgive us our sins and to cleanse us from all unrighteousness (1 John 1:9). This forgiveness is not just a legal pardon but a transformational power that enables believers to live a new life in Christ, free from the slavery of lust.
Practical Steps to Purity
- Seek Professional Help: For some, the struggle with lust may require professional intervention, such as counseling or therapy. The Bible encourages believers to seek wisdom and help when needed.
- Accountability Software and Filters: Utilizing technology that blocks access to pornographic material or provides accountability for one’s online activities can be a practical step in avoiding temptation.
- Healthy Relationships: Building and maintaining healthy, platonic relationships can help redirect emotional and physical desires into appropriate channels.
- Service to Others: Engaging in service to others can help shift focus away from self-centered desires and cultivate a sense of purpose and fulfillment.
